About this House

Check out this STUNNING center hall colonial in the heart of Patchogue Village! This recently renovated gem feels like home, complete with four generously sized bedrooms with gleaming hardwood floors, and two and a half beautiful and timeless bathrooms.

Recent updates more than meet the eye! Behind the gorgeous kitchen, freshly painted walls and luxury vinyl flooring on the main level, there are maximum energy efficiency upgrades including the heating and cooling systems, electrical systems, and dense packed insulation.

With more rooms than you'll know what to do with, a full basement, and a two car attached garage with ample driveway space, you do not want to miss out on this one. Welcome home!
62 Howard Street, Patchogue, NY 11772 is a 4 bedroom, 3 bathroom, 2,272 sqft single-family home built in 1960. It last sold for the $750,000 asking price on May 15, 2026. It is currently off market. The Trulia Estimate is $761,300, with a rent estimate of $4,449/month.

  • Michellegarnettcarrick
    "Alive at Five, Midnight on Main, Parades with Santa, on St Paddy’s Day, etc. Breakfast with the Easter Bunny at the firehouse. Breweries, eateries, pubs, bars, restaurants on mainstreet in addition to a VINYL RECORD SHOP, Theatre AND independent-movie cinema (not to be confused). Bowling Alley, Archery, walking tours, cycling, Fire Island Ferry, Ryder Sports Fields Complex, waterfront park with playground, even convenience stores, fast food and box stores near by. It’s a GREAT PLACE TO LIVE, for single parents, singles (blue or white collar),newlyweds, married professionals,married with families, retirees, families with seniors (new assisted living communities). There is something for EVERYBODY here in Patchogue, NY!!!"
